FileFormat by Terri--MNArchives Made available to The USGenWeb Archives by: Cecelia McKeig Submitted: August 2003 ========================================================================= The Nelson Family Cemetery is a private cemetery located in Port Hope Township, Beltrami County near the village of Tenstrike. It is one block off Highway 23 along Red Pine Lane NW. The oldest burial is Clarence A. Nelson 1904 - 1909. The cemetery was visited on June 29, 2003 by Cecelia McKeig, Jacob McKeig and Leona O'Neal, granddaughter of Joseph and Mary Hampl. Transcription was done the same day by the Hampl relatives. Nelson Family Cemetery: Last Name First Name Dates Other text/figures or information Bryant Cullen C. 1880-1937 Bryant W.C. 1855-1930 Cronk Deree A. 10/21/1889-08/07/1919 Cronk Garrett 1859-1941 Father Cronk Jasper L. 04/19/1894-01/15/1951 MN 79 Co Trans Corp WW I Cronk William W. 02/04/1881-06/07/1959 Donahue Walter C. 1917-1919 Fleischman Carl A. 06/13/1932 MN Pvt 32 Engrs. Hampl Esther 04/23/1897-06/01/1921 Hampl Joseph 1871-1927 Father Hampl Mary 1876-1945 Mother Lerum Joe I. 09/06/1870-01/23/1921 Nelson Baby 11/01/1918-11/11/1918 Rest in Peace Nelson Benona 1874-1933 Nelson Bruce B. 1934-1977 Nelson Clarence A. 07/23/1904-04/02/1909 Nelson Gilford M. 1853-1935 Nelson Lawrence J. 1905-1960 Nelson Loren R. 06/18/1930-09/12/1987 SSGT US Air Force, Korea Nelson Minnie E. 1880-1959 Nelson Roger L. 1943-1975 Nelson Vernie J. 05/05/1898-11/09/1918 Co. 4. 30th-Engrs Nelson-Usher Esther M. 1911-1980 Mother Puffe Alice 03/25/1936-12/25/1936 Reinard Matthew 1840-1934 Reinard Rose 1906-1917 St. Laurence Agnes M. 02/12/1893-03/05/1937 Wetherbee Blythe 1929-1930 (Child was struck by lightning during a summer storm)
